Marina Rivon

Marina Rivón is a Professional Graphic Designer, Author and Principal Partner of Maremar Graphic Design. Maremar is a marketing driven graphic design studio based in the island of Puerto Rico. Her goal is to help business owners make the maximum of their visual identities and develop marketing materials that will help grow their businesses. Or not! Finding designers to interview for your next design project is a fairly simple process. Finding the right match for your particular job is more complicated. You will find that there are many different types of designers. From the independent professional to the larger design firms; from specialized shops that deal with one type of product (annual reports, packaging) to professionals that have a wider range of experience, although maybe not as deep as the specialists in their particular areas.
